Privacy Code Scan

Your microTALK radio can automatically scan the

Privacy

Codes

(either CTCSS 01 through 38 or DCS 01 through 104)

within one channel. Only one set of privacy codes (CTCSS
or DCS) can be scanned at a time.

To scan privacy codes:
1.

While in

Standby

mode, press the

Channel Up

or

Channel Down

button

to choose the channel on which you
wish to scan privacy codes.

2.

Press the

Mode

button until either the CTCSS

or the DCS icon appears on the display and
the

Scan

icon and the privacy code numbers

flash on the display.

3.

Press the

Channel Up

or

Channel Down

button to begin scanning privacy codes
within the channel you selected.

The

Scan

icon will continue to be displayed

when privacy code scan is

on

. Your radio will

continue to scan privacy codes and stop as an
incoming transmission is detected. Your radio
will remain on that channel/privacy code for
10 seconds.

While setting privacy code scan, if you do not
press any buttons for 15 seconds, your radio
will automatically return to

Standby

mode on

the channel/privacy code that was displayed
before you entered mode functions.
